[PATCH 10/33] aio: implement IOCB_CMD_POLL

From: Christoph Hellwig
Date: Wed May 23 2018 - 14:37:05 EST


Simple one-shot poll through the io_submit() interface. To poll for
a file descriptor the application should submit an iocb of type
IOCB_CMD_POLL. It will poll the fd for the events specified in the
the first 32 bits of the aio_buf field of the iocb.

Unlike poll or epoll without EPOLLONESHOT this interface always works
in one shot mode, that is once the iocb is completed, it will have to be
resubmitted.

+/* need to use list_del_init so we can check if item was present */
+static inline bool __aio_poll_remove(struct poll_iocb *req)
+{
+ if (list_empty(&req->wait.entry))
+ return false;
+ list_del_init(&req->wait.entry);
+ return true;
+}
+
+static inline void __aio_poll_complete(struct poll_iocb *req, __poll_t mask)
+{
+ struct aio_kiocb *iocb = container_of(req, struct aio_kiocb, poll);
+ struct file *file = req->file;
+
+ aio_complete(iocb, mangle_poll(mask), 0);
+ fput(file);
+}
+
+static void aio_poll_work(struct work_struct *work)
+{
+ struct poll_iocb *req = container_of(work, struct poll_iocb, work);
+
+ __aio_poll_complete(req, req->events);
+}
+
+static int aio_poll_cancel(struct kiocb *iocb)
+{
+ struct aio_kiocb *aiocb = container_of(iocb, struct aio_kiocb, rw);
+ struct poll_iocb *req = &aiocb->poll;
+ struct wait_queue_head *head = req->head;
+ bool found = false;
+
+ spin_lock(&head->lock);
+ found = __aio_poll_remove(req);
+ spin_unlock(&head->lock);
+
+ if (found) {
+ req->events = 0;
+ INIT_WORK(&req->work, aio_poll_work);
+ schedule_work(&req->work);
+ }
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static int aio_poll_wake(struct wait_queue_entry *wait, unsigned mode, int sync,
+ void *key)
+{
+ struct poll_iocb *req = container_of(wait, struct poll_iocb, wait);
+ struct file *file = req->file;
+ __poll_t mask = key_to_poll(key);
+
+ assert_spin_locked(&req->head->lock);
+
+ /* for instances that support it check for an event match first: */
+ if (mask && !(mask & req->events))
+ return 0;
+
+ mask = file->f_op->poll_mask(file, req->events);
+ if (!mask)
+ return 0;
+
+ __aio_poll_remove(req);
+
+ req->events = mask;
+ INIT_WORK(&req->work, aio_poll_work);
+ schedule_work(&req->work);
+ return 1;
+}
+
+static ssize_t aio_poll(struct aio_kiocb *aiocb, struct iocb *iocb)
+{
+ struct kioctx *ctx = aiocb->ki_ctx;
+ struct poll_iocb *req = &aiocb->poll;
+ __poll_t mask;
+
+ /* reject any unknown events outside the normal event mask. */
+ if ((u16)iocb->aio_buf != iocb->aio_buf)
+ return -EINVAL;
+ /* reject fields that are not defined for poll */
+ if (iocb->aio_offset || iocb->aio_nbytes || iocb->aio_rw_flags)
+ return -EINVAL;
+
+ req->events = demangle_poll(iocb->aio_buf) | EPOLLERR | EPOLLHUP;
+ req->file = fget(iocb->aio_fildes);
+ if (unlikely(!req->file))
+ return -EBADF;
+ if (!file_has_poll_mask(req->file))
+ goto out_fail;
+
+ req->head = req->file->f_op->get_poll_head(req->file, req->events);
+ if (!req->head)
+ goto out_fail;
+ if (IS_ERR(req->head)) {
+ mask = EPOLLERR;
+ goto done;
+ }
+
+ init_waitqueue_func_entry(&req->wait, aio_poll_wake);
+ aiocb->ki_cancel = aio_poll_cancel;
+
+ spin_lock_irq(&ctx->ctx_lock);
+ spin_lock(&req->head->lock);
+ mask = req->file->f_op->poll_mask(req->file, req->events);
+ if (!mask) {
+ __add_wait_queue(req->head, &req->wait);
+ list_add_tail(&aiocb->ki_list, &ctx->active_reqs);
+ }
+ spin_unlock(&req->head->lock);
+ spin_unlock_irq(&ctx->ctx_lock);
+done:
+ if (mask)
+ __aio_poll_complete(req, mask);
+ return -EIOCBQUEUED;
+out_fail:
+ fput(req->file);
+ return -EINVAL; /* same as no support for IOCB_CMD_POLL */
+}
